Design and fitment

The Cooler Master Hyper 212 Halo Black is a single-tower air cooler rated for about 160 W of sustained heat at acceptable noise. It stands 154 mm tall, which fits most mid-tower and many compact cases, and does not overhang the memory slots, so RAM height is not a concern.

Mounting kits for AM4, AM5, LGA1200, LGA1700, LGA1851 are in the box. Every current desktop socket is covered.

Which processors it suits

Across the 120 processors it can mount, the Hyper 212 Halo Black rates Excellent on 41 (34 %) and a throttling risk on 52. The most power-hungry chip it holds comfortably is the Core i5-10400 at 134 W (estimated 85 °C under full load). Throttling risk begins around 162 W parts such as the Ryzen 7 7800X3D.

In practice that makes it a good match for 65 W class processors and compact builds where height matters more than headroom.

Terms used on this page

Sustained dissipation rating
The continuous heat load, in watts, a cooler can remove at acceptable noise. This site uses realistic sustained figures rather than marketing peak numbers, and models temperature as ambient plus load ÷ rating × a per-load scale.
Thermal headroom
The cooler's sustained dissipation rating minus the CPU's boost power limit, in watts. Positive headroom lets fans run slower and quieter; 25 W or more is rated Excellent here.
RAM clearance
The tallest memory module that fits under an air cooler's front fan in its stock position. Dual-tower coolers with less than 42 mm clash with tall RGB kits (typically 44 mm) unless the fan is raised.
CPU cooler height
The installed height of an air cooler from the motherboard, compared against the case's published CPU cooler clearance. Coolers at or above 160 mm exclude many compact Micro-ATX and tempered-glass mid-towers.
